- #include "pthread.h"
- #include "implement.h"
- static int
- pte_cond_unblock (pthread_cond_t * cond, int unblockAll)
- {
- int result;
- pthread_cond_t cv;
- int nSignalsToIssue;
- if (cond == NULL || *cond == NULL)
- {
- return EINVAL;
- }
- cv = *cond;
-
- if (cv == PTHREAD_COND_INITIALIZER)
- {
- return 0;
- }
- if ((result = pthread_mutex_lock (&(cv->mtxUnblockLock))) != 0)
- {
- return result;
- }
- if (0 != cv->nWaitersToUnblock)
- {
- if (0 == cv->nWaitersBlocked)
- {
- return pthread_mutex_unlock (&(cv->mtxUnblockLock));
- }
- if (unblockAll)
- {
- cv->nWaitersToUnblock += (nSignalsToIssue = cv->nWaitersBlocked);
- cv->nWaitersBlocked = 0;
- }
- else
- {
- nSignalsToIssue = 1;
- cv->nWaitersToUnblock++;
- cv->nWaitersBlocked--;
- }
- }
- else if (cv->nWaitersBlocked > cv->nWaitersGone)
- {
-
- if (sem_wait (&(cv->semBlockLock)) != 0)
- {
- result = errno;
- (void) pthread_mutex_unlock (&(cv->mtxUnblockLock));
- return result;
- }
- if (0 != cv->nWaitersGone)
- {
- cv->nWaitersBlocked -= cv->nWaitersGone;
- cv->nWaitersGone = 0;
- }
- if (unblockAll)
- {
- nSignalsToIssue = cv->nWaitersToUnblock = cv->nWaitersBlocked;
- cv->nWaitersBlocked = 0;
- }
- else
- {
- nSignalsToIssue = cv->nWaitersToUnblock = 1;
- cv->nWaitersBlocked--;
- }
- }
- else
- {
- return pthread_mutex_unlock (&(cv->mtxUnblockLock));
- }
- if ((result = pthread_mutex_unlock (&(cv->mtxUnblockLock))) == 0)
- {
- if (sem_post_multiple (&(cv->semBlockQueue), nSignalsToIssue) != 0)
- {
- result = errno;
- }
- }
- return result;
- }
- int
- pthread_cond_signal (pthread_cond_t * cond)
- {
-
- return (pte_cond_unblock (cond, 0));
- }
- int
- pthread_cond_broadcast (pthread_cond_t * cond)
- {
-
- return (pte_cond_unblock (cond, PTE_TRUE));
- }
